Order of kinetics for thermoluminescence in LiF TLD-100

Results are presented on the decay of glow peak V (1900C) in powder as well as single crystal chip samples of LiF. The absence of peak IV (1700C) is confirmed and any contribution from higher temperature glow peaks is accounted for, to ascertain that the decay represents the uncontaminated peak V. It is also ascertained that the decrease in TL due to precipitation of impurities does not effect these decay data of comparatively short duration. The order of kinetics is determined by two methods: (i) isothermal decay and (ii) total glow peak. In addition, the applicability of a variable heating rate method is examined for inferring the order kinetics. (author)
